The phrase "Nan vangum suvasangal ellam" (meaning "Every breath I take is air you gave me") is a deeply evocative lyric from the song "Oru Kaditham" (I Wrote a Letter) from the 1995 Tamil movie Deva. While originally a classic from the 90s, it has seen a massive resurgence as a trending ringtone and social media background track due to its timeless emotional weight. The Origin: A 90s Classic
The song features the legendary vocals of S.P. Balasubrahmanyam and the film's lead actor Vijay (in his early career), with music composed by Deva and lyrics penned by the iconic Vaalee. It is a soulful melody that captures the essence of deep, perhaps unrequited or long-distance, love. Lyrical Depth and Theme
The specific line "Nan vangum suvasangal ellam nee thantha kaatru" is the emotional core of the track. It translates to: "Every breath I inhale is the air you have given me."
This metaphor elevates the partner from a mere companion to a life-sustaining force, suggesting that the protagonist's very existence is dependent on the love and memory of the other person. Why It’s a Popular Ringtone Today
